Field Service IT Technician – FULL UK DRIVING LICENSE AND CAR ESSENTIAL

Are you a hands-on IT professional with strong hardware expertise and experience supporting HP equipment?

We are looking for a skilled and customer-focused Field Service IT Technician to cover Reading, Basingstoke and surrounding locations down to Bristol. This is a varied, hands-on role providing both on-site and remote technical support within a managed service environment.

We need candidates with strong experience working with HP laptops, desktops and associated hardware, and ideally someone who has completed HP technical training or holds relevant HP certifications/accreditations.

The Role

As a Field Service IT Technician, you will be responsible for diagnosing, repairing and maintaining a range of IT equipment, including HP laptops, desktops, RPOS systems and associated hardware and peripherals.

You will troubleshoot hardware and software issues, replace and upgrade components, install and configure operating systems, and ensure devices are operating reliably and at peak performance.

Working directly with users, you will provide professional technical support while offering practical guidance on device care, maintenance and IT best practices.

Technical Skills & Experience

The successful candidate should have a strong technical background in PC and laptop hardware, with particular emphasis on HP equipment.

Essential / Highly Desirable Technical Skills:

Strong hands-on experience supporting and repairing HP laptops and desktop PCs

Excellent knowledge of PC hardware architecture and fault iagnosis

Experience replacing laptop and desktop components at board and module level

Strong understanding of BIOS/UEFI, firmware, device drivers and hardware configuration

Experience diagnosing issues involving system boards, memory, SSDs/HDDs, displays, batteries, keyboards, power supplies and peripherals

Good working knowledge of Microsoft Windows instadllation, configuration and troubleshooting

Experience using hardware diagnostic utilities and following structured fault-finding procedures

Understanding of networking fundamentals, including TCP/IP, Wi-Fi and basic connectivity troubleshooting

Experience supporting printers, peripherals and associated end-user equipment

Familiarity with IT service management, ticketing systems and working within defined SLAs

Ability to accurately record diagnostic findings, repairs, replacement parts and technical resolutions
